草庐IT

在线绘制富集分析多组气泡图和单细胞分析marker基因矩阵气泡图

常规的GO或者KEGG通路富集分析结果通常以气泡图的形式展示,然而这个气泡图仅仅是一个比较的结果,如果想在一张图上展示多个比较的结果,就需要用到多组气泡图(图1,左侧)。单细胞RNA-seq分析结果中,矩阵形式的气泡图可以很好地展示marker基因(X轴)在不同cluster(Y轴)中的表达情况(图1,右侧)。             图1.矩阵气泡图(左侧为带“缺失值”的点阵,右侧为完整的点阵)在dotplot中,点的大小代表一个维度,点的颜色代表另一个维度。因此,凡是具有二维特征的矩阵(或者带有缺失值的矩阵),都可以使用dotplot轻松可视化。1.打开绘图页面首先,使用浏览器(推荐chr

在线绘制富集分析多组气泡图和单细胞分析marker基因矩阵气泡图

常规的GO或者KEGG通路富集分析结果通常以气泡图的形式展示,然而这个气泡图仅仅是一个比较的结果,如果想在一张图上展示多个比较的结果,就需要用到多组气泡图(图1,左侧)。单细胞RNA-seq分析结果中,矩阵形式的气泡图可以很好地展示marker基因(X轴)在不同cluster(Y轴)中的表达情况(图1,右侧)。             图1.矩阵气泡图(左侧为带“缺失值”的点阵,右侧为完整的点阵)在dotplot中,点的大小代表一个维度,点的颜色代表另一个维度。因此,凡是具有二维特征的矩阵(或者带有缺失值的矩阵),都可以使用dotplot轻松可视化。1.打开绘图页面首先,使用浏览器(推荐chr

2千多组英语单词形近词库ACCESS\EXCEL数据库

很多单词样子都差不多,有时总是会记错,而今天这一份2000多组英语单词形近词库就是解决这个难题的,你可以列出其中一个中文解释让用户选择正确的单词,也可以列出其中一个英语单词让用户选择正确的解释,来加深对这些单词的记忆。大部分都是2个单词一组的,具体统计为:2个单词一组共有1277组,3个单词一组共有373组,4个单词一组共有201组,5个单词一组共有103组,6个单词一组共有58组,7个单词一组共有27组,8个单词一组共有22组等。截图下方有显示“共有记录数”,截图包含了表的所有字段列。该数据提供ACCESS数据库文件(扩展名是MDB)以及EXCEL文件(扩展名是XLS)。

php - 从给定的多组集合中找出最佳组合

假设您有一批cargo。它需要从A点到B点,从B点到C点,最后从C点到D点。你需要它在五天内以尽可能少的钱到达那里。每条航段有三个可能的托运人,每个航段都有自己不同的时间和成本:Array([leg0]=>Array([UPS]=>Array([days]=>1[cost]=>5000)[FedEx]=>Array([days]=>2[cost]=>3000)[Conway]=>Array([days]=>5[cost]=>1000))[leg1]=>Array([UPS]=>Array([days]=>1[cost]=>3000)[FedEx]=>Array([days]=>2[co

REDIS - 多组交集

我是Redis的新手,所以这个问题可能很愚蠢,但我想在这里绕过SINTER命令。问题是我有多个SET,我试图在它们上面创建一个INTER。当我单独执行它时,它会得到结果,但是当我传递多个参数时,它返回空。我阅读了关于INTER的文档,它告诉我们如果任何提供的arg是一个空的SET,它什么都不会返回,但是我所有的SET都是非空的,有人可以帮助我吗!#belowstatementshouldreturn{'758','762','752'}127.0.0.1:6379>SINTERAsset:allAsset:id:2275Asset:id:2280Asset:id:2269(emptyl

python - 如何使用多组模板为 Flask 应用程序组织代码

我正在使用Flask编写应用程序,我想为桌面和移动浏览器生成不同的代码。恕我直言,保持应用程序代码相同并在模板级别将提供不同内容的问题推到堆栈中应该是一个好主意-因此它本质上变成了为两个用例编写两组模板并找到一种方法的问题在每个请求中选择正确的使用。我在Flask中使用默认的Jinja2模板引擎。我应该提一下,我没有使用Flask的经验,我在编写代码时正在学习它-我也把它当作练习:)您会使用什么机制来解决这个问题并尽可能保持源代码干净? 最佳答案 回复我自己:)我最终使用了这个解决方案:importflask#patchflask.

python - 来自 Pandas 数据框的多组重复记录

如何从数据框中获取所有现有的重复记录集(基于列)?我得到了如下数据框:flight_id|from_location|to_location|schedule|1|Vancouver|Toronto|3-Jan|2|Amsterdam|Tokyo|15-Feb|4|Fairbanks|Glasgow|12-Jan|9|Halmstad|Athens|21-Jan|3|Brisbane|Lisbon|4-Feb|4|Johannesburg|Venice|23-Jan|9|LosAngeles|Perth|3-Mar|这里的flight_id是我需要检查重复项的列。并且有2组重复项。此特

9. Fabric2.2 区块链农产品溯源系统 - 多组织集群部署

区块链农产品溯源系统涉及多个角色,包括农户、加工厂、物流机构、零售商、消费者,他们属于不同的组织结构,需要部署区块链节点,这里需要把消费者剔除,消费者是不会部署区块链节点的,本小节我们将构建4组织的区块链集群。1.设计区块链集群前几节部署的Demo只有两个组织,每个组织一个节点,一个Orderer节点。该项目根据要求,部署四个组织,每个组织一个节点,一个Orderer节点(Orderer节点的数量,我们在农产品溯源项目结束后进行扩展,现阶段需要逐步吸收知识)定义四个组织org1.example.comorg2.example.comorg3.example.comorg4.example.co

mongodb - 使用 Mongodb 聚合框架的多组操作

给定一组关联调查和类别ID的问题:>db.questions.find().toArray();[{"_id":ObjectId("4fda05bc322b1c95b531ac25"),"id":1,"name":"Question1","category_id":1,"survey_id":1,"score":5},{"_id":ObjectId("4fda05cb322b1c95b531ac26"),"id":2,"name":"Question2","category_id":1,"survey_id":1,"score":3},{"_id":ObjectId("4fda05d9

python - 找到多组交集的最佳方法?

我有一个集合列表:setlist=[s1,s2,s3...]我想要s1∩s2∩s3...我可以编写一个函数来执行一系列成对的s1.intersection(s2)等有推荐的、更好的或内置的方法吗? 最佳答案 从Python2.6版开始,您可以对set.intersection()使用多个参数,喜欢u=set.intersection(s1,s2,s3)如果集合在列表中,则转换为:u=set.intersection(*setlist)其中*a_list是listexpansion请注意,set.intersection不是静态方法,